HOME
SHOWS
GALLERY
EXCLUSIVE OFFERS (TEXT US)
CONTACT
More
Thu, Jul 21
Armadillo Den
Jul 21, 10:00 PM
Armadillo Den, 10106 Menchaca Rd, Austin, TX 78748, USA